What is a SS file?

The .SS file extension does not belong to a single format and is shared by many different software programs. Most often, an .SS file is a screenshot from the game EVE Online, which is actually a standard JPEG image. Another common format is the SilverStripe Source Code File. Web developers use these files with the SilverStripe content management system to build website templates. The .SS extension is also used for Microsoft Cosmos structured stream data, Samsung Smart TV firmware updates, and music notation files in SmartScore. Additionally, network switches from Cisco and Brocade generate .SS files as compressed diagnostic support logs.

How to open SS files?

Because .SS has multiple possible meanings, you must know the origin of your file before you can open it. If your file is a screenshot from EVE Online, you can view it with basic image viewers like Windows Photos or Apple Preview. You might need to rename the file extension to .JPG. If you have a SilverStripe Source Code File or a script file, you can open it with a code editor like Visual Studio Code or Notepad++. Diagnostic logs from network switches usually require command-line tools to decompress and read the data. Firmware files for TVs should not be opened manually; they are read directly by the hardware during system updates.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is an .SS file?

It can be one of many formats. An .SS file might be an EVE Online screenshot, a SilverStripe Source Code File, or a Samsung TV firmware update.

How do I open an .SS screenshot?

Use any standard image viewer. Screenshots from EVE Online are typically standard JPEG images saved with an .SS extension.

Can I edit a SilverStripe .SS file?

Yes, you can edit it with a text editor. A SilverStripe Source Code File contains plain text and template code, which opens easily in tools like Visual Studio Code.

What is a SmartScore .SS file?

It is a music notation file. Created by SmartScore, this format stores scanned sheet music data and requires the original software to open.
